"Unfortunately, we don't know. Our findings are based on big data at the population level, we need to work with other disciplines to get to understand the mechanisms," Ding said.
Interestingly, the consumption of vegetables and the effects on mood, although highly beneficial for both sexes, was less pronounced in men.
"The association is much stronger with women. Why? we can't say," she said.
"There could be a true biological difference between men and women or perhaps women are better at reporting their diets and their stress levels?"
